Andy Ebon to deliver opening keynote at Wedding MBA

lecturn stage 250x240 Andy Ebon to deliver opening keynote at Wedding MBAIt has been confirmed that Andy Ebon, The Wedding Marketing Authority, will deliver the opening keynote presentation at the Wedding MBA Conference on Tuesday morning, September 21st.

His address, titled: Wedding Prosperity Begins Now! will set the tone for the 3-day conference, expected to attract some 1500 attendees from around the globe.

Andy Ebon is a public speaker, writer, and business consultant, focused on the Wedding Industry. He publishes The Wedding Marketing Blog and is a regular contributor to Mobile Beat Magazine and Wedlock Magazine.
